    No, no money was debited, normally we would have used a credit card and are very careful with our debit cards and bank details but we had just cancelled the credit card as we've just got a mortgage. We've never had a problem buying on the internet in the past so thought it would be safe. He has informed the bank, they've cancelled his card and put in a visa dispute but it's down to the fraud team as to whether they think it is fraud. We don't know anyone abroad and have never used WU before so hopefully we'll get the money back. I cancelled my card just in case, i'm not saying it is definately this site we just can't see any other way of his details getting out. It's a hard lesson learnt that's why I wanted to warn people.

    Lauraloo - you are not alone in this. The same thing happened to me around 3/4 weeks ago only I got my emails the other way around (cancellation first and then confirmation from someone called Heather). I tried to contact them to ask what was going on but no reply. They were based in Guernsey so they didn't appear on companies house - apparently Guernsey based companies are registered differently. The site appeared to be secure with the yellow padlock in the corner etc but I just had a gut feeling that something was wrong. So I rang my card company and explained and they just cancelled my card and gave me a new one. They did take all the web details though and shortly after I noticed that the site appeared to be "under construction."

    So to the poster who insinuated that Lauraloo was winding you all up, no she wasn't and I believe that others have been scammed in the same way.
